1/2 Crown - George I
Issuer | United Kingdom |
Year | 1715-1726 |
Type | Standard circulation coin |
Value | 1/2 Crown (1/8) |
Currency | Pound sterling (1158-1970) |
Composition | Silver (.925) |
Weight | 15.05 g |
Dimensions | 33 mm |
Thickness | |
Shape and Technique | Round
|
Orientation | Coin alignment ↑↓ |
Engraver(s) | Obverse: John Croker Reverse: Johann Ochs |
In circulation to | 31 December 1969 |
Reference(s) | KM#540, Sp#3642-4 |
Obverse description | Laureate and draped bust of King George I right, legend around. |
Obverse script | Latin |
Obverse lettering | GEORGIVS·D·G·M·BR·FR·ET·HIB·REX·F·D· (Translation: George by the Grace of God King of Great Britain France and Ireland Defender of the Faith) |
Reverse description | Crowned cruciform shields with central Garter star, divided date above, legend around. Note: varieties exist (see below) |
Reverse script | Latin |
Reverse lettering | BRVN
ET·L·DUX S·R·I·A·TH ET·EL·17 17· (Translation: Duke of Brunswick and Luneburg, High Treasurer and Elector of the Holy Roman Empire) |
Edge | Regnal year in words, e.g anno regno tirtio means third year of |
